Practical Tips for Choosing an Online Casino
1. Research Licensing and Regulation
Ensure that any online casino you consider is licensed by a reputable authority. In Australia, look for licenses from the Northern Territory or other recognised jurisdictions. These licenses ensure that operators follow strict guidelines to promote fair play.
2. Read User Reviews and Ratings
User feedback can provide invaluable insights into an online casino’s reputation. Check independent review sites or forums to see what other players have experienced regarding payouts, customer service, and gameplay fairness.
3. Evaluate Payment Options
A trustworthy casino should offer multiple secure payment methods including credit cards, e-wallets like PayPal or Skrill, and bank transfers. Be cautious if a site only accepts limited options or asks for unusual payment methods.
4. Test Customer Support Services
A reliable online casino will have responsive customer support available through various channels such as live chat, email, or phone. Reach out with questions before committing to playing; this will help gauge their service quality.

Pros and Cons of Online Casinos in Australia
- Pros:
- Diverse game selection including slots, table games, and live dealers.
- The convenience of playing from home at any time.
- Attractive bonuses and promotions to enhance player experience.
- Cons:
- Potential for addiction due to easy access.
- The risk of encountering unlicensed operators.
- Lack of face-to-face interaction compared to land-based casinos.
